Ensure the QA Evaluations column is enabled
While viewing Cradle to Grave, select "Edit Columns" in the top right
Select "QA Evaluation Results" in the available columns. It's best practice to also have "Recording" and "Transcript" enabled as well.
Filtering for Evaluated Calls (Optional)
You may use Cradle to Grave criteria filters to find only calls that have been evaluated or specific graded calls.
Select the "Criteria +" icon in the filter pop out to define the criteria further:
Here are a few common examples.
- To only view calls that have been scored. Add a criteria of "Is Scored" = "True"
- To only view calls with a low total evaluation score (below 40% as an example)
-
Search for "evaluation" and select the applicable Total Score (%) value. In this case, the template name is "Sales Playbook"
-
Define the operator as < and a value of "40" which represents less than 40%
-
You will find many other filter options as you explore
Apply your filter to see the results
Opening a Scored Evaluation
Note: A call must have completed and needs some time to process the recording and evaluation before you'll see it in Cradle to Grave. Any call that has evaluated will include the following icon:
Selecting the icon will open the call recording and full call transcript.
You'll find the evaluation in the header of the transcripts here:
You'll see the total evaluation score as a percent and as the points awarded
To open the evaluation, click on "View Results"
Reviewing a Scored Evaluation
When an evaluation is opened, you'll see a total score at the top and a breakdown of the individual evaluation points in the bottom section.
If you'd like to see additional details about how an evaluation point and why it was given the applicable score, you may click on the Details column for the evaluation point. This will expand the view to show you:
-
This only applies to evaluation points with a "Text Response" answer type. It will list the AI feedback in text format.Text Response (not shown here)
You will not see this field for "Yes/No" or "Scale" answer types.
This will display the configured prompt being sent up to AI to grade this evaluation point. Though it matches what an administrator configured for the evaluation, it makes it visible to the manager or supervisor so they might recognize the guidance given. This is not editable from this screen.Evaluation Prompt -
Every evaluation point will include an explanation from AI as to why it gave the score/result it did. This is a great place to see a breakdown on what the agent did correctly but also what else they could have done better.AI Explanation -
This is an optional feature allowing the reviewing manager to reinforce or dispute the result with a thumbs up or thumbs down.Feedback 👍 👎-
👍 will reinforce the provided result and will be used as a positive example as AI continues to grade the associated evaluation point on future calls
-
👎 is used when the reviewing manager does not fully agree with given result. When selected, the user will be prompted to fill out a short with the following:
-
"Why didn't you agree with the evaluation?": Here the manager may enter why they disagree with the assessment given. They should be thorough in explaining what portion of the transcript supports their stance. This will be used to help AI fine-tune its evaluations to better assess future evaluations
-
"What score would you have given?:" This is applicable for Scale answer types exclusively. Since the user may want to suggest a lower or higher score than what was given, they'll have to suggest what score they would have given.
-
-
Feedback will be documented after submission and can be deleted as needed:
Feedback does NOT update the current or past evaluationsThough the feedback will help future evaluation performance, it will not change the score of any completed evaluations . This includes the open evaluation where the feedback was provided.
